>> [trunkgroups]
>> trunkgroup = 1,24,96
>> spanmap = 1,1,0
>> spanmap = 2,1,2
>> spanmap = 3,1,3
>> spanmap = 4,1,1
>>
>
> You caused the behavior you are seeing by configuring your spanmap this
> way; you've got physical span #4 configured as the second span in the
> trunkgroup, so Zaptel will treat physical channels 73-95 as logical
> channels 1/1 through 1/23.
>
If it were configured as the second span, shouldn't is be channels 25-48
rather than 1-23? voip-info was very unclear about this when I looked
at it over a year ago. I finally got it working by trying different
combinations in spanmap.
